Ready-to-use electrophoresis buffers, gels, and powder stains quickly sort sample molecules based on size and charge. These reagents generate less background fluorescence that can negatively impact visual studies. To achieve the necessary chemical reaction, select the type of stain based on environmental conditions and experiment goals. From commonly used Coomassie Brilliant Blue to the specific cancer researching Papanicolaou, sensitive electrophoresis stains detect and make cell components visible for further DNA and RNA analyses.

Description: The Pierce Silver Stain Kit is a rapid, ultra-sensitive, and versatile silver stain system for protein detection in polyacrylamide gels, yielding consistent and reliable results. It is a metallic silver (Ag) protein stain that yields a remarkably clear and uniform gel background. In standard mini gels, proteins are detectable at greater than 0.25 ng per band or spot. The protocol has been optimized for flexibility by allowing short or overnight gel fixation and staining steps without affecting staining performance (sensitivity or clarity). A short (one-minute) sensitization step, performed after gel fixation, yields results that are free of the characteristically dark or blotchy backgrounds often seen with homemade or other commercially available silver stains. This feature is beneficial when performing densitometric analysis of silver stained gels.
